Details
A vulnerability classified as critical was found in Elated-Themes Leroux Plugin up to 1.4 on WordPress. Affected by this vulnerability is some unknown functionality.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a deserialization v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-502. The product deserializes untrusted data without sufficiently verifying that the resulting data will be valid. As an impact it is known to affect conf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The summary by CVE is:
Deserialization of Untrusted Data vulnerability in Elated-Themes Leroux leroux allows Object Injection.This issue affects Leroux: from n/a through < 1.4.
The weakness was disclosed by Denver Jackson. It is possible to read the advisory at patchstack.com. This vulnerability is known as CVE-2026-32507 since 03/12/2026. The exploitation appears to be easy. The attack can be launched remotely.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not publicly available.
Upgrading to version 1.4 eliminates this vulnerability.
